Genus Hordeum includes several cereal grasses commonly known as barley. Some synonymous terms for this genus include Hordeum vulgare, common barley, Hordeum sativum, cultivated barley, Hordeum distichum, two-row barley, and Hordeum hexastichum, six-row barley. These species are typically used for food and beverage production, with barley being a key ingredient in beer and whiskey production. Barley is also used in animal feed and as a cover crop to prevent soil erosion. This diverse genus is widely cultivated worldwide, with different varieties adapted to different climatic conditions.
